What Are We Testing During a Penetration Test?

The execution of our vulnerability assessment and penetration testing (VAPT) is composed of three main phases explained below:
Active & Passive Reconnaissance

Information gathering about the target organization, as well as identify underlying components such as operating systems, running services, software versions, etc. The following is a non-inclusive list of items that will be tested to allow us to craft our attack in an informed fashion, elevating our probability of success:

  • Open domain search
  • DNS investigation
  • Public information search (search engines, social networks, newsgroups, etc.)
  • Network enumeration
  • Port scanning, OS fingerprinting, and version scanning
  • Firewall enumeration


Vulnerability Identification

Assessment that consists of evaluating the information assets in scope against 80'000+ vulnerabilities and configuration checks, in addition to CWE/SANS TOP 25 Most Dangerous Software Errors and OWASP Top Ten vulnerabilities. wizlynx group uses several vulnerability scanners, as well as manual techniques, to test the many services that are reachable via the network such as SMTP, HTTP, FTP, SMB, SSH, SNMP, DNS, etc. The following vulnerability types can be identified (non-inclusive list):

Service-Side Exploitation

  • Remote code execution
  • Buffer overflow
  • Code Injection
  • Web Application exploitation (XSS, SQLi, XXE, CSRF, LFI, RFI, and more)

Network Manipulation & Exploitation

  • VLAN Hopping attacks
  • ARP Spoofing
  • HSRP/VRRP Man-In-The-Middle attack (MiTM)
  • Routing Protocols MiTM

Identity & Authentication Weakness Exploitation

  • Default username and password
  • Weak and guessable user credentials

Privilege Escalation

  • Race conditions
  • Kernel attacks
  • Local exploit of high-privileged program or service

Vulnerability Exploitation

Using a hybrid approach (automated and manual testing), our security analysts will attempt to gain privileged access to the target systems in a controlled manner by exploiting the identified vulnerabilities in previous phase “Vulnerability Identification”.

Supported Web Application Testing Approaches

wizlynx group’s web application testing services support the following testing approaches when assessing web apps:

Blackbox Testing Approach

Refers to testing a system without having specific knowledge of the inner workings of the information asset, no access to the source code, and no knowledge of the architecture. This approach closely mimics how an attacker typically approaches a web application at first. However, due to the lack of application knowledge, the uncovering of bugs and/or vulnerabilities can take significantly longer and may not provide a full view of the application's security posture


Greybox Testing Approach

Refers to testing the system while having some knowledge of the target asset. This knowledge is usually constrained to the URL of the application, as well as user credentials representing different user roles. Greybox testing allows focus and prioritized efforts based on superior knowledge of the target system. This increased knowledge can result in identifying more significant vulnerabilities, while putting in much less effort. Therefore, greybox testing can be a sensible approach to better simulate advantages attackers have, versus security professionals when assessing applications. Registered testing allows the penetration tester to fully assess the web application for potential vulnerabilities. Additionally, it allows the tester to verify any weaknesses in application authorization which could result in vertical and/or horizontal privilege escalation.


Whitebox Testing Approach

Refers to testing the system while having full knowledge of the target system. At wizlynx group, our whitebox pentest is composed of a greybox test combined with a secure code review. Such assessments will provide a full understanding of the application and its infrastructure’s security posture
